The brief

Cheshire East Council is currently reviewing the model for its Care at Home services, ahead of a recommissioning of the service.

This will potentially involve moving away from the traditional borough-wide framework approach to a Neighbourhood Model.

Under this new model, providers would operate within defined geographical areas of the borough, working collaboratively with residents, the Council, and partner organisations.

The aim is to deliver outcomes-focused, strengths-based care that reflects the unique needs and demographics of each local community.

The number of providers operating within each neighbourhood will be determined by local demand and population need.

Overall, the model would focus on a smaller number of providers than currently are on the framework, with a stronger emphasis on: • Provider stability • Continuity of care • Building sustainable local partnerships To support the successful design and implementation of this model, Commissioners are seeking to understand: • Where current providers are operating across Cheshire East • Future intentions for geographic delivery (subject to procurement outcomes) • Interest from new or out-of-area providers in establishing services within the borough We would greatly appreciate you taking the time to complete this survey.

Your responses will help us to: • Understand current service provision across the borough • Identify providers' future geographic intentions • Explore capacity, growth plans, and potential constraints • Inform the development of a sustainable neighbourhood-based commissioning model
